Becoming Bank of America In the first half of the 20th century, A.P. Giannini led Bank of America to become the largest bank in the world. Starting as a San Francisco neighborhood bank in 1904, the Bank of Italy catered to the working and ethnic classes of the Italian North Beach district. read more
